Anastacia was called to the healing arts in 2001. Nearing her graduation in her exercise science degree, she was introduced to the ayurvedic studies of using essential oils, herbs, and self care modalities like massage to heal and balance the body. She describes her draw toward it as intoxicating. The minute she graduated u of d, she attended dawn training institute and she became a licensed massage therapist.
As her first interest was exercise science and very medically oriented, she wanted to work with injuries to become masterful at healing the physical body. During this time she realized she would need more skills and earned a master's certification in myofascial release and structural integration from Mount Nittany School of healing arts, and describes this as the foundation of her practice. For the next 20 years and over 25,000 hours of practice, she would incorporate new modalities viewing the body as physical, emotional, mental, and spiritual, creating the ultimate experience for her clients on the table.
